What’s the Wabi Sabi Philosophy?

Wabi Sabi Philosophy

Alright, Wabi Sabi is that tricky idea in Japanese aesthetics that, actually, centers around accepting the idea of transience and imperfection. That, yeah, instead of chasing perfection –which seems exhausting –it finds attractiveness in simplicity, naturalness, and even the marks of wear and tear. This view believes, almost, that things gain beauty through their history and unique features, so that’s totally what makes it so unique. As a matter of fact, think of an antique bowl with a crack, carefully repaired; the repair doesn’t, actually, hide the flaw, but rather enhances the bowl’s story and character.

Now, how does Wabi Sabi relate to bonsai? Well, you know, it’s all about seeing beauty in what might be, so to speak, considered imperfections like aged bark, asymmetrical designs, or the tree’s, so to speak, natural response to its location. That is, in its own way, that each bonsai is seen as that thing that has its own life and story. It’s not that thing about forcing a tree to look that certain way. It is, very, actually helping it express what it truly is, even, at the end of the day, if that thing means a little asymmetry or visible aging.
